Anyway, I asked David what more can we do to my new HTA35R Turbo? And David didn’t answer me, he just started he’s magic work…..
He started with the stock turbo compressor housing
Scribed the housing with a Titanium 2.125 big block Chevy intake valve
The housing scribed, and you are looking for the line that goes around the inner diameter
He use a high helix carbide burr to grind the material away
The housing ported
Now David "polishing" it with 60 grit and beautified with a 120 grit sanding roll….I love this picture!!
David done the same with the exhaust housing

Is that too much?
I am no-way an expert on this, but can't you go too far with porting and have it hurt peformance.
It seems like he removed a lot of material, so couldn't this now cause more turbulence from the compressor to the intercooler and actually slow the air down?
How much better would this better vs a really good polishing?
